Professional Background
Kristopher Li is a highly skilled mechanical engineer and designer with a deep-rooted passion for product design, robotics, and mechatronics. With a proven history of innovation and an enthusiasm for sustainability, Kristopher has carved a niche for himself in the realm of advanced engineering. Currently, he serves as a Mechanical Engineer at Roam Robotics, where he leverages his extensive knowledge and expertise in mechanical engineering to drive advancements in robotics technology. His career path showcases a unique blend of hands-on experience and engineering proficiency that spans various roles and organizations.
Education and Achievements
Kristopher's academic journey began at the prestigious University of Pennsylvania, where he earned a Bachelor of Science (BSc) in Mechanical Engineering. His outstanding performance led him to continue his studies at the same esteemed institution, where he successfully completed a Master of Science (MSc) in Mechanical Engineering. During his time at the university, he was exposed to cutting-edge research and innovations in the field, further fueling his interest in robotics and product design.
Over the years, Kristopher has accumulated a wealth of experience through various internships and research roles, contributing to his development as an engineer. He held the position of Research Engineer and 3D Print Hardware Inventor at HP Labs, where he was pivotal in pioneering significant advancements in 3D printing technologies. His role involved developing innovative hardware solutions that enhanced the capabilities of 3D printing applications, an area that intersects significantly with product design and sustainability.
Additionally, Kristopher's role as a Senior Robotics Hardware Engineer at Futurewei Technologies, Inc., allowed him to delve deeper into robotics hardware, where he applied his engineering skills to contribute to the design and development of robotic systems. This experience was complemented by his internship at Autodesk as a User Workflows Research Intern, enhancing his understanding of user-centered design in the realm of technology and fabrication.
